Icebreaker Toolkit: Simple Openers That Actually Work

Feeling unsure what to say is normal—use that energy to send something clear, low-pressure, and personal. Start by scanning the profile for one small, specific detail (a photo, a hobby, a favorite band or travel shot) and build a short message around that. Specifics beat vague compliments every time.

Reliable opener patterns

  • Observation + question: "I love that road-trip photo—where was that taken?"
  • Playful choice: "Pizza or tacos for a Friday night? I need to know if we can survive a dinner decision."
  • Quick callback: Reference something in their profile and add a tiny challenge: "You said you hike. Worst trail you ever tried? I’ll tell mine if you tell yours."
  • Mini curiosity: "That vinyl shelf is impressive—what record do you always put on first?"

How to keep it low-pressure

  • Ask for short, shareable answers (one sentence or a choice), so replying feels easy.
  • Keep humor light and avoid sarcasm that could be misread in text.
  • Use your name once or a casual sign-off if you want: it adds warmth without being intense.

What to avoid

  • Avoid generic openers: "Hey" or "You’re cute" don’t give anything to respond to.
  • Skip overly intense or invasive questions early on (e.g., relationship history, finances, family drama).
  • Don’t copy-paste the same line to multiple people—small personal touches show you noticed them.

Adaptable message templates

  1. Profile hook: "You mentioned [interest]. What’s one thing about it you’d recommend to a complete beginner?"
  2. Image prompt: "That photo at [place or activity] looks fun—what made you take it?"
  3. Two-option prompt: "Morning coffee or evening tea—what’s your pick and why?"

Try one opener at a time, tweak the wording to match your voice, and remember that a short friendly follow-up can revive a stalled chat: a simple "That’s great—tell me more" can work wonders. Small effort + specific detail = better conversations on Mingle2.
